What companies run services between Geneva, Switzerland and Eurotunnel Folkestone Terminal, England?

You can take a train from Geneve to Eurotunnel Folkestone Terminal via Paris Gare de Lyon, Paris Nord, London St Pancras Intl, and Folkestone West in around 9h 1m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Geneva - Bus Station to Eurotunnel Folkestone Terminal via Paris - Bercy-Seine Bus Station, Paris, Quai de Bercy (Bercy Seine), and Folkestone in around 13h 46m.
